On The Green to launch at Liverpool One


Grosvenor has announced the signing of a premium golf simulation concept, On The Green, for its first ever site at Liverpool One.

Founded in Liverpool with local business and family roots, On The Green has selected a 4,700 sq ft. space on The Terrace for its debut venue which is set to further elevate Liverpool One’s rich leisure offering.

Set to safely launch once Covid-19 lockdown restrictions are lifted, the immersive golf experience has been designed with both professional and novice golfers in mind, to cater to patrons of all abilities.

On the Green’s revolutionary technology allows customers to play a full 18-hole round of golf with a real club and golf ball, providing active analysis on spin rate, projection and club swings while PGA professionals are available to offer lessons to complete beginners or those wanting to hone their skills.

The new venue will also make full use of its unique terrace, which offers panoramic views over the city’s Chavasse Park, Albert Dock, River Mersey and both Liverpool Cathedrals. The external space will be equipped with a bar for both alcoholic and non-alcoholic ‘clubhouse’ drinks, comfortably accommodating family outings, social gatherings and formal business meetings alike.

The multi-faceted golf concept will enable users to play a number of the world’s top courses within a relaxed and informal environment. On The Green will provide top brand golfing equipment for use whilst in the simulators to ensure accessibility for all, bolstering the comprehensive golfing experience.

Upon opening, On The Green will operate in line with all applicable Covid-19 regulations, in conjunction with the strict health and safety measures in place across Liverpool One.
